The Mechatronics program at Kaunas University of Technology in Lithuania is designed to equip students with interdisciplinary knowledge combining mechanical engineering, electronics, computer science, and control systems. This comprehensive course enables students to design, develop, and maintain automated and intelligent systems used in modern industries. With a strong focus on practical applications, students engage in hands-on projects, laboratory work, and industry collaborations, fostering innovation and problem-solving skills. The curriculum covers robotics, embedded systems, sensors, actuators, and programming, preparing graduates to meet the demands of evolving technological landscapes. Graduates emerge as skilled professionals capable of contributing to sectors such as manufacturing automation, automotive, aerospace, and smart technologies. The program's blend of theory and practice ensures readiness for both industrial careers and advanced studies in engineering fields, making it an excellent choice for aspiring engineers passionate about integrating mechanical and electronic systems.

Applicants to the Mechatronics program must hold a secondary education certificate equivalent to the Lithuanian high school diploma. A strong background in mathematics and physics is essential. Applicants are required to submit certified copies of their academic transcripts, a motivation letter, and proof of English proficiency. Some programs may require an entrance exam or interview to assess technical knowledge and problem-solving skills. International students must also provide a valid passport and meet the university's health insurance requirements. Meeting these criteria ensures readiness for the technical and interdisciplinary nature of the program, fostering student success in an engineering environment.

Applicants must demonstrate proficiency in English, typically through recognized tests such as IELTS (minimum 6.0) or TOEFL (minimum 80). Alternative proof of English skills, like previous education in English or university-conducted language assessments, may also be accepted. Meeting these requirements ensures that students can successfully engage with academic content and participate in discussions.

International students admitted to the Mechatronics program must apply for a Lithuanian student visa (type D). The process requires an official university acceptance letter, proof of sufficient financial resources, health insurance, and accommodation details. Visa applications are submitted at the Lithuanian embassy or consulate in the applicant's home country. Processing times can vary, so early application is advised. Upon arrival, students must register their residence with local authorities to comply with immigration regulations.

After completing the Mechatronics degree, international graduates can apply for a residence permit extension in Lithuania to seek employment for up to 12 months. This post-study work option enables graduates to gain practical experience and start their professional careers in Europe. Many graduates find positions in automation, robotics, and engineering firms within Lithuania and the wider EU. The university also provides career support services, including job fairs and networking events, to assist graduates in securing employment.
